What is a forged hub?
A forged hub is a barrel-shaped, center-mounted metal part of the tire’s inner contour that supports the tire on the shaft. It is also called hub rim, steel rim, hub, and tire bell. Many types of hubs depend on diameter, width, forming method, and material.
Forged hubs are manufactured by forging, which can remove internal pores and cracks to the greatest extent possible. Moreover, the frequent use of multiple forgings can ensure the removal of various material defects, increase the internal stress of the material, improve toughness, and greatly improve impact and tear resistance at high speeds.
Advantages and disadvantages of forged hub hubs
The advantages of forged hubs are high strength, higher safety factor, strong plasticity, lightweight, good heat dissipation, and fuel economy. At the same time, forging hubs is also the most advanced method of hub manufacturing. The strength of this type of hub is approximately 1-2 times that of cast hubs and 4-5 times that of most iron hubs. Naturally, it is sturdy and collision-resistant, with significantly stronger toughness and fatigue strength than cast hubs, making it less prone to crushing and fracture. The only drawback is that the price and production cycle are expensive.
Types of forged hubs
According to the characteristics and needs of different car models, the surface treatment process of hub hubs will also adopt different methods, which can be roughly divided into two types: baking paint and electroplating. The hubs of ordinary car models are less considered in appearance, and good heat dissipation is a basic requirement. The process is treated with baking paint, which means spraying first and then electric baking. The cost is relatively economical, and the color is beautiful, with a long retention time. Even if the vehicle is scrapped, the color of the hubs remains unchanged. Many Volkswagen car models use baking paint as the surface treatment process for hub hubs. Some fashionable and dynamic-colored hubs also use baking paint technology. This type of hub has a moderate price and complete specifications. Electroplated hubs can be divided into silver electroplating, water electroplating, and pure electroplating. Electroplated silver and water-plated hubs, although bright and vivid in color, have a shorter retention time, making them relatively inexpensive and popular among many young people who pursue freshness. Pure electroplated hubs, with a long-lasting color retention time, are of excellent quality and high price.

The Forging Process of forged hubs
Forging Forming Technology of Automotive Aluminum Alloy Hub
(1) Workmanship of forgings. The processability of forgings mainly considers the material, shape, dimensional accuracy, and surface quality of the forgings. The specific instructions are as follows:
-
1. Materials. Materials forged using the open-die forging method can generally undergo closed-die forging. Some materials with poor plasticity are more advantageous to use closed die forging. Generally, aluminum alloy, magnesium alloy, and other light metal and non-ferrous alloys are used for die forging because these kinds of alloys have low temperatures during die forging, are not easy to produce oxidation, and die wear is small.
-
2. Shape. Rotating forgings, such as gear blanks, hubs, bearings, etc., are most suitable for integral die forging. For forgings with complex shapes, as long as they can be removed from the cavity during die forging, integral die forging can be used. If integral die forging cannot be used, separable die forging can be used. All rotating forgings and some forgings with complex shapes can also be precision forged.
-
3. Dimensional accuracy and surface quality. In the process analysis and mold design of forging forming, various factors that affect the accuracy of forgings should be considered. Specific analysis and calculation should be carried out to determine the dimensional accuracy of forgings. However, due to the complex influencing factors, it is theoretically difficult to calculate accurately.
(2) Specific steps for forging and forming automotive aluminum alloy wheels. The main content of the forging process for hubs involves the following 9 aspects:
-
Firstly, draw forging drawings based on product part drawings;
-
The second is to determine the die forging process and auxiliary processes (including rotary forging, pre-forging, final forging, expanding edge cutting, and spinning), and determine the shape and size of the intermediate blank;
-
The third is to determine the heating method and heating specifications;
-
The fourth is to determine the method for removing the oxide skin or decarburization layer on the surface of the billet;
-
The fifth is to determine the size, weight, and allowable tolerances of the blank and select the cutting method;
-
Sixth, select equipment;
-
Seven is to determine the lubrication and cooling methods for the billet and mold;
-
Eight is to determine the cooling method and cooling specifications for forgings;
-
Nine is to determine the heat treatment method for forgings.
The heat treatment method of forgings and the technical and inspection requirements for forgings should be determined based on the specific parts produced.
The difference between forged and cast hubs
Technology | Forging | Casting |
Raw Material | 6061 Aviation Aluminum | A356.2 Aluminum |
Manufacturing Method | Metal Block High-Pressure Forming | Melted Metal Poured Into The Mold And Cooled Before Removal |
Price | More Expensive | Commonly |
Density | Close Together | Commonly |
Internal Pores | Nothing | Less |
Strength | High Strength, Uniform Inside | The Strength Is Average, But Different Parts Have Different Strengths |
Weight (17 Inches As An Example) | Approximately 7kg Per Unit | Approximately 9kg Per Unit |
Selection Elements of Forged Hub
There are three factors to consider when selecting a hub.
Size
Don’t blindly increase the hub. Someone artificially increases the hub to improve car performance. When the outer diameter of the tire remains the same, the large hub is necessary to match the wide and flat tire. The lateral oscillation of the car is reduced, and stability is improved. When turning, it is like a dragonfly skimming water, lightly passing by. But the flatter the tires, the thinner their thickness, and the poorer their shock absorption performance, requiring significant sacrifices in terms of comfort. In addition, if there are slight obstacles such as stones, the tires are easily damaged. Therefore, the cost of blindly increasing hubs cannot be ignored. Generally speaking, it is most appropriate to increase the size of the original car hub by one or two sizes.
